Six of Swords

Six of Swords — The 1909 London Deck

Six of Swords — Minor Arcana, from The 1909 London Deck.

Upright

moving on, passage, calmer water ahead

Leaving something difficult behind for something quieter. The crossing is slow and it goes the right way.

In a yes or no reading, Six of Swords upright answers yes.

Reversed

unable to leave, baggage carried, a delayed departure

The move is stalled, or being made while carrying everything you meant to leave.

In a yes or no reading, Six of Swords reversed answers maybe — the situation has not settled.
